May 21, 200323 yr Hey John, that "skeleton module" you sent me is turning out to be very interesting! I've managed to get it working, such that it gets loaded when FS starts, and has complete access to all data elements defined in the Panels and Guages SDK. I'm planning on developing it further, basically as an alternative to FSUIPC. Should have something ready for beta-testing this week or next.There are a few areas where it will provide less access than FSUIPC, such as no access to weather or AI information. However, the method of data access is fully conformant to the Panels and Guages SDK, so as long as MS doesn't make any major changes there, this module should work with future versions of MS with no alteration required!I'll keep you all posted.Russ Dirks
